Here are a couple of ways in which corporate collaborations with nonprofits benefit the taking part organizations as well: Most consumers wish to feel that the business they do business with are credible, caring, and conscientious. Partnering with a not-for-profit assists a service demonstrate how completely it embodies these worths. If neighborhood members see organizations ending up being involved with nonprofit volunteering events and volunteer work, they are most likely to believe highly of those companies and patronize them in the future.
Companies can also reference the corporate-nonprofit collaboration in their internal marketing products, highlighting that they are proud to support the great of the nonprofits they partner with. These opportunities assist raise the organization's presence in the public eye and produce favorable brand name associations. Employees who feel great about their work environments are most likely to be more efficient and remain with the business for longer.
Companies that partner with nonprofits are likely to see much better employee morale. Understanding that a service belongs to a mission to do great in the community is likely to make workers feel favorable about the service and take pride in working there. Ideally, companies want to partner with nonprofits that their customer base will be thrilled about.
Or they may be nonprofits whose mission intersects with the client base's interests in some method state an outside equipment business partners with a nature conservancy. If the customer base is delighted to hear about the new collaboration, they might be more inclined to continue patronizing business. Of course, business stay in business to optimize their profits, and working with a not-for-profit frequently offers a method to do just that.
Others might come from the positive brand name association the partnership offers. Whatever the factor, most organizations will think about a business collaboration a successful one if it has a net positive influence on the company's profits. Many corporate partners will request for documents of how they have actually contributed and how far their contributions or efforts have gone.

Here are some tips for beginning corporate-nonprofit partnerships: One of the first actions in building nonprofit-corporate collaborations is to choose what types of business would make sense as partners for your volunteer organization.
If you can connect the business's location of proficiency to your nonprofit volunteering work even better. An animal shelter might partner with a business like PetsMart or PetCo, or a food bank might partner with a regional grocery chain. Whatever connections you might have in the community, utilize them to get intros with local services.
Once you have actually recognized a few promising businesses, make sure your values are lined up. No financial advantage is worth partnering with an organization if you wouldn't be proud of the alliance think of how you would feel seeing your 2 names together on a banner at your next event.
When you're meeting potential partners, see if there are methods which your not-for-profit can help resolve a few of their issues. For example, a food bank or homeless shelter looking for food contributions may be able to partner with a grocery or hotel chain seeking to reduce food waste.
Not all charity-and-business collaborations will be such best fits, however searching for locations where a company may wish to improve can be key. What levels of donation, nonprofit volunteering, or sponsorship would make business sponsorship worth the financial investment of your energy and time? Consider the contributions you would need to get from a corporate partner versus the advantages that would simply be nice to have.
Make certain to interact plainly about your not-for-profit's vision and objectives also. If you require to take in a specific quantity of revenue each year for your programs to be viable, state that upfront. Or if your goal is to expand your literacy programs into 10 more schools or surrounding cities, elaborate on those strategies.
When you have actually found an excellent fit, ensure you meet in person to hammer out the details of your collaboration. Being clear about your wishes in advance and getting contractual information spelled out in writing can assist make certain your collaboration is advantageous, harmonious, and efficient for several years down the road.

Numerous kinds of business not-for-profit collaborations exist. To pick the very best design for you, think about the various types listed below. These corporate-nonprofit partnerships use a series of methods and advantages. In this type of sponsorship, a business sponsors programs or occasions for a not-for-profit. The nonprofit markets the business's name and the business helps cover the cost for the event.
This kind of collaboration enhances community bonds and benefits both the not-for-profit and business assisting to support the not-for-profit event. This type of corporate-nonprofit partnership empowers services to straight contribute to a not-for-profit's mission. Contributions can be monetary or in-kind donations products like blankets, canned food or new laptop computers.
Direct donations benefit nonprofits through a company's resources, and they benefit companies through neighborhood involvement. In this model, businesses send workers to work at nonprofits as volunteers.
Supporting not-for-profit employees with volunteer services is another way this collaboration can work. This type of corporate collaboration occurs when a service collects worker donations for a not-for-profit.
Instead of getting donations from workers, these projects are open to whoever wants to contribute. They generally include contribution stations and special promotions like contributing modification. These charity events can be available in lots of shapes and sizes, however their primary objective is to raise financial assistance for a not-for-profit. Organizations benefit from the fundraising event due to the fact that potential customers see that they're bought supporting the regional neighborhood.
